Augury is a prayer that increases Magic accuracy by 20% and Defence by 25%. It requires both level 70 Prayer to use. Augury currently has the highest prayer level required for any prayer in the default prayer book. Augury is unlocked by completing the Knight Waves Training.

Considering the way in which it is unlocked, the boosts, and prayer level required, this prayer may be considered the magic equivalent of the melee prayer Piety.

Trivia

  • This is the only magic boosting prayer in the standard prayer book that does not have the word "Mystic" in its name.
  • If you try to set Augury as one of your Quick Prayers before unlocking it, the message reads: "You can buy this prayer from Daemonheim. You also need a Prayer level of 74.". However, this is wrong, as you actually need a Prayer level of 70 for Augury and Rigour. Upon the arrival of the Evolution of Combat, the two prayers are now unlocked upon completion of Knight Waves Training Ground.
  • Before the Evolution of Combat, Augury was unlocked through the scroll of augury, a Dungeoneering reward.
